About Kimber Severance

Facebook | Instagram | Threads | Twitter | LinkedIn | Pinterest | Medium

kimber severance writer

‍Title: Finance Writer, Blog Manager, Editor

Expertise: personal finance, finance, saving, budgeting, loans

Education: BA in English and a minor in Editing from Brigham Young University

Kimber Severance is a writer and editor from Pennsylvania. While her roots remain in the forested hills of the East Coast, she has also lived for many years in the mountainous deserts of the West Coast. Severance has been an avid writer all her life, writing novels, short stories, poems, booklets, pamphlets, webpages, articles, social media posts, and more. She has a great love for words and all the ways they can inform, help, and inspire readers.
